Elderberry Syrup Recipe

(reposted from Food Moxie)
* 4 cups water
* 1 cup dried elderberries
* 2 tbls. fresh chopped ginger
* 1 tsp. cloves
* 1 cinnamon stick
* 1 tbls. dried rose hips
* 1/4-1/2 cup honey
Combine all ingredients except honey in large saucepan and b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Lower the heat and simmer for 30 minutes. Pour through a sieve or cheesecloth into a glass container. Press leftover berries and ingredients to extract all the juice. Add honey and stir until dissolved.
This elixir should keep for several months. Suggested use: take 1 tsp, 2-3 a day for cold prevention.

Electrolytes (homemade Gatorade, as shared by Odilia Galvan Rodriguez)

1 liter of water

1/2 t. baking soda

2 T. agave nectar

1/2 T. sea salt

juice of a lemon (if you have it)

Mix all ingredients, drink slowly and stay hydrated.
